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Court of Criminal Appeal The Court of Criminal Appeal has now been in existence for nearly three and a half years - a sufficient time for the determination of most of the main principles which govern its action, and therefore, perhaps, to permit the appearance of a book which seeks to show, in some measure, the Court in actual being. As is perhaps inevitable in the introduction of any great change, the expression of many fears as to the evil results of the establishment of a Court of Criminal Appeal marked the moment of its birth. It was said that the number of appeals would be so large and the work so great as to almost cripple the trial of civil disputes; that the cost entailed would be enormous; that there would be an interference with vital principles which would be fraught with far-reaching consequences the reverse of good, and that all this would be the outcome of a development in our system of criminal jurisprudence which was quite un necessary, since the administration of the criminal law was so near perfection as to call for no supervision. It is easy to be wise after the event, and few people will now say that these fears have been realised. Leaving out the incomplete year 1908, the number of applications for leave to appeal and appeals was 627 in 1909 and 712 in 1910. For the nine months of this year the number is 474, as compared with 520 last year, so that the years do not reveal any steady increase. When it is borne in mind that, roughly speaking, some persons are convicted each year who may appeal to the Court, the number of actual appellants is seen to be remarkably small.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Criminal Appeals: Under the Criminal Appeal Act of 1907; With Rules of Court and Forms In the second place, on a petition to the Home Office the prisoner's case only is before it. The result of that is that the Home Office has to discover the case against the prisoner, to test his conviction and his guilt in order to establish, if possible, his innocence. In the third place, there is no legal finality in the. Position of the Home Secretary. The consequence is that, although he might come to a clear and definite decision, he is always exposed to pressure to reconsider his decision. Book excerpt: Excerpt from A Treatise on New Trial and Appeal, Vol. 2 of 2 Of the Subject - The first step to be taken by a party who desires to have a judgment or order reviewed in the supreme court or in the district court of appeal is to give his notice of ap peal. The next thing in order is to file in the court below an under taking on appeal in the sum of three hundred dollars, and in some cases, if a stay of execution be desired, an additional undertaking must be filed. After this a record on appeal must be prepared if one be not already in existence. When the record is complete and on file in the court below, the appellant must have a copy or tran script of it printed and filed in the proper appellate court.
